At Sitemetric, we turn technology into services that transform how the world is built.
This enables our customers to lead the change in critical areas of construction operations: workforce, safety, security, reporting, communications, logistics, and more.
We work closely with owners, general contractors, subcontractors, and construction workers to customize offerings to their needs, including digital onboarding, smart badging, real-time location systems, messaging and mass texting, integrated turnstiles, real-time reporting, emergency mustering, and more.
We currently serve as trusted partner to a growing number of the US's largest, most forward-looking owners and contractors, working with them to ensure what we offer meets their evolving needs, with thousands of companies and workers already on the Sitemetric platform. As Field Tech III you will be a critical member of our on-the-ground team, ensuring smooth operations and optimal technology performance on customer construction sites.
Working closely with leadership, you will be responsible for deploying and configuring IoT sensor systems; ensuring all devices are properly installed and connected; management of wireless network infrastructure across job sites, documentation and other support related to system performance, technical optimization, and other responsibilities as needed. This role ensures that critical data relating to site operations is appropriately captured and transmitted so that customers have accurate, real-time insights to make important decisions.
The Field Tech III plays a pivotal role in ensuring operational excellence across customer construction sites. Beyond performing installations and technology deployments, this position includes field leadership - managing a small team (or 'pod') of Field Techs, providing real-time technical oversight, and ensuring adherence to company standards and project specifications.
The Field Tech III will also serve as an on-site mentor and trainer for new and junior technicians, instilling Sitemetric's values of quality, safety, and reliability while maintaining high performance and accountability across the team.
